Glossy before-and-after pictures tell just a bit of the tale. A thorough groom generally consists of a health-adjacent check that can locate problem long before a veterinarian browse through is required. Proficient pet dog groomers Reno NV owners depend on do greater than clip and wash.
For pet dogs, a full-service groom begins with a pre-bath assessment of layer condition and skin. A groomer will feel for mats behind ears, in the underarms, and under the collar. They will seek burrs or sap, keep in mind ear odor, and examine the tail base where hot spots flare in summer. After that comes a cozy bath with a hair shampoo fit to the coat and skin. For instance, Reno's dry air makes mild, moisturizing formulas useful for short-coated types in wintertime. Conditioners or de-shedding therapies include slip that aids launch undercoat in double-coated pet dogs like huskies, shepherds, and retrievers. Post-bath, drying out is a large piece of the safety problem. Hand-drying with a high speed clothes dryer rates the process and raises loosened hair, however it ought to be coupled with hearing protection for the pet and careful tracking. Cage clothes dryers prevail also, preferably room temperature or low heat, with timers and supervision.
The finishing stage, the component most people take pet grooming, is coat-specific. A doodle or poodle mix will need scissoring and clipper collaborate with cautious brushing to prevent blades from skipping over concealed knots. A golden or husky need to not be cut for convenience unless a vet has a clinical factor, because that layer insulates against heat and sunburn. Instead, use de-shedding and clean trims to keep feathering clean. Nails, paw pads, and hygienic trims round out the solution. Toenail length matters in our trail-heavy town; thick nails alter joint angles and can harm on granite or decomposed granite paths around Galena Creek and Peavine.
Cat grooming is a different craft. Felines have thin, fragile skin and a reduced tolerance for restraint and sound. Good feline brushing services are quieter, much faster, and lower stress. Several cats succeed with a bathroom and comb-out for shedding seasons, plus sanitary and stubborn belly trims for long-haired types. A full lion cut is a choice for heavily matted layers or for elderly cats that no longer self-groom, yet it must be done thoughtfully to prevent sun exposure in summer season. Some pet cats just will not endure a beauty salon environment. Mobile grooming or cat-only days can lower anxiety. Sedation needs to be managed by a vet, not by a groomer.
Season, altitude, and terrain alter the grooming image here.
In wintertime, completely dry air and indoor warmth can bring about dandruff and itchy skin. A groomer could suggest lengthening the bathroom interval slightly and including a light conditioner. Booties help on salted walkways, yet not all pet dogs approve them. A paw balm and more constant pad trims keep ice balls from developing between toes after a walk at Thomas Creek.
Spring and very early summer bring foxtails. These barbed turf awns can work into layers, paws, and ears, and they are far easier to avoid than to remove at a veterinarian. Ask your groomer to pay special focus to feet, armpits, under the tail, and the edge of the ear natural leather. Brief trims in those risky zones can help while maintaining the stability of dual coats.
Summer fun around rivers, Lake Tahoe excursion, or a dip at Triggers Marina leaves layers wet. Quick drying is not just about comfort. Dampness trapped under thick coats can develop hot spots within a day. A professional blowout after water journeys can conserve you a veterinarian see. Wash after freshwater swims, especially if algae advisories have actually been published in the area, and schedule an appropriate bath to get rid of residue.
Fall is sticker season. Burrs and cheatgrass hold on to downy legs and tails. This is when regular comb-outs in the house expand the time between complete brushing check outs. For long-haired felines that track burrs indoors from Midtown backyards or the Old Southwest, a hygienic trim and paw fur clean can reduce the mess.

Reno has a mix of shop hair salons, mobile vans, and bigger operations. As opposed to going after the trendiest Instagram, utilize a couple of sensible filters.
First, search for transparent plans. You want clear check-in treatments, launch types that discuss drying out techniques, flea policies, and what happens if your pet reveals indications of stress and anxiety. Ask that will certainly work with your pet and whether the same individual can deal with most appointments for continuity. Peek at the holding areas. Some pets rest fine in kennels, others do better in a tiny space separated by entrances. Neither is inherently right, but an excellent pet brushing solution matches the arrangement to the dog.
Second, inquire about training. Nevada, like the majority of states, does not have a formal state permit certain to brushing, so you are looking for trade qualifications, mentorship, and ongoing education rather than a government-issued credential. Worry Free accreditation, PetTech emergency treatment training, or memberships in expert organizations show intent to keep skills current. Experience with your specific coat kind matters more than any kind of glossy device. A groomer who deals with 3 goldendoodles a day will have different hands-on knowledge than a person that concentrates on terrier hand-stripping.
Third, examine the drying technique. Drying is where a great deal of danger lives. The concern to ask is straightforward: just how do you dry out a double-coated dog, and how do you check pet dogs while they completely dry? Sensible responses point out high rate hand-drying for the majority of the coat, cage clothes dryers set to ambient or low warmth, timers, and continuous staff existence in the drying out area.
Finally, research before-and-after images with an eye for layer honesty and expression, not simply ideal bows. Take a look at feet, tail collection, and face proportion. On cats, check out how close the lion cut goes on the body and whether the neck shift looks smooth instead of dramatically edged.

Rates vary with size, layer kind, and condition, however a lot of pet groomers Reno citizens utilize come under a foreseeable array. Bath and brush services for tiny short-haired dogs typically run in the 40 to 60 buck variety. Full bridegrooms for tiny to medium types that need clipper job, think shih tzu or cockapoo, generally land between 65 and 120 bucks depending upon layer problem. Big double-coated pet dogs needing de-shedding are frequently 80 to 140 dollars, occasionally much more throughout peak shed season if the undercoat is influenced. Felines are typically 70 to 120 dollars for a bathroom and tidy, with lion cuts on the greater end as a result of the skill and safety and security considerations. Mobile services typically add 10 to 30 dollars over beauty parlor prices, mirroring traveling time and special attention.
There are surcharges that can stun people. Extreme matting takes time and has to be taken care of safely, which typically implies a brief clip rather than cleaning out limited knots that pluck skin. Senior pet dogs and special delivery for fear or aggression may include price. An excellent shop explains these fees up front and gets approval prior to proceeding if the estimate requires to change.
Grooming timetables right here adhere to the climate. Late springtime through early summer season is peak for shedding. Around that time, lots of shops publication 2 to 3 weeks out for full grooms. Holiday weeks fill quickly too. To stay clear of the shuffle, set a recurring schedule that matches your pet's coat. For a doodle kept in a medium clip, every 4 to 6 weeks maintains hair workable and prevents matting. For double-coated breeds, a bathroom and blowout every six to eight weeks via springtime and early summertime makes home brushing a lot easier. Short-coated dogs can typically go eight to twelve weeks between expert bathrooms, with nail trims in between.
Cats have their very own rhythm. Long-haired cats often benefit from seasonal visits in springtime and autumn, plus hygienic trims as required. Older pet cats or those with health conditions may require extra regular assistance as grooming ends up being uncomfortable for them.
Hygiene is not attractive, yet it matters. Devices must be decontaminated in between pets, towels cleaned warm, and tubs sterilized after every usage. If your pet dog picks up a skin infection after swimming, tell the groomer so they can adjust items and methods. Inoculation plans differ, however lots of beauty salons need evidence of rabies at minimum. Some request for Bordetella for dogs, especially in busier shops. If your pet has a transmittable problem like fleas, anticipate the appointment to be rescheduled or relocated to an isolated slot with a flea therapy and a sanitation charge. That is excellent policy, not a money grab.
Emergencies are unusual, however plans ought to exist. Ask exactly how the staff manages a clipper nick, what emergency treatment training they have, and which veterinary facility they call if something urgent takes place. You will find out a lot about a group by how they answer.
Many animal groomers like cats but do not accept them, which is practical. Cat grooming requires a quieter room, firm however gentle handling, and an efficient approach. An appropriate feline configuration limitations pets in the space, utilizes non-slip mats, and shortens the appointment. Scruffing should be stayed clear of for towel wraps or a groomer's helper to support securely when needed. For long-haired felines, routine comb-outs with a stainless steel comb are more efficient than slicker brushes at stopping mats at the skin level. When a coat is already pelted, the humane choice is a short clip. The ideal groomer will not embarassment you, they will certainly get your cat comfy once again and help you prepare a maintenance schedule.
Mobile pet grooming radiates with cats, particularly older ones from areas like Caughlin Ranch or Dual Ruby that are used to quiet. Individually sessions reduce noise and scent triggers. If your cat requires sedation to tolerate pet grooming, speak to your vet beforehand. A groomer can not legitimately, and should not fairly, carry out sedatives.

Coat care has compromises. Brushing out severe floor coverings is painful and high-risk. Clipper blades ride on a cushion of hair. When hair is limited to skin, blades can catch. A compassionate groomer will certainly recommend a brief clip if mats are thick at the skin. This is not a failure, it is a reset. Afterwards reset, a practical upkeep strategy might be a shorter design every 4 to six weeks plus quick comb-outs at home every various other day. For an owner with an active routine, that plan keeps a doodle or Persian comfortable.
Shaving dual layers is a different problem. Individuals typically ask for a summer season shave to maintain a husky cool. That undercoat works as insulation versus warmth and sunlight. A close cut eliminates that function and can change layer texture as it regrows. Better to set up a bathroom and de-shedding treatment, then neat paws, stubborn belly, and sanitary locations, and utilize color, amazing water, and time of day to take care of heat.
We live outside here. Nails that are as well long catch on disintegrated granite and transform the method joints stack, which gradually can make hips and wrists hurt. The majority of pet dogs gain from trims every 2 to 4 weeks, a lot more frequently if the quicks are lengthy and require to decline slowly. Ask your groomer to show you just how long-hair cat grooming to preserve at home with a grinder, and routine stand-alone nail brows through in between complete bridegrooms. Paw pads grab sap, burs, and mini cuts, particularly on the Seeker Creek trail and Galena's granite steps. A pad balm after walks helps, and a quick rinse in the tub or at a self-wash eliminates bothersome dust.

Reno's climate can move by 30 levels within a week. Skin that looked penalty in a damp March can be half-cracked by April. Shops sometimes switch over hair shampoos seasonally for regulars, making use of oatmeal or aloe blends during the driest months and lighter cleansers after summer season swims. Also, wildfire smoke influences skin and lungs. On heavy smoke days, keep outdoor time short and routine interior, low-stress activities for pet dogs. If a family pet coughings or has dripping eyes, inform your groomer. They can keep the session mild and avoid heavy fragrances.
Finally, we live near high desert plants that leave stubborn materials. Pine sap and tumbleweed pieces can adhesive hair hairs with each other. Do not battle those with scissors at home. A solvent-based, pet-safe item and client combing after a bath usually wins without reducing a hole in the coat.

FFF in dog grooming stands for “Full Fur Finish” or “Full Fancy Finish,” depending on the salon. It indicates a complete grooming session, including bath, haircut, brushing, nail trim, and sometimes ear cleaning. The term helps groomers and clients communicate the level of service. Not all groomers use the abbreviation, so clarification may be needed.

Grooming a dog can take 4 hours due to factors such as coat length, matting, breed-specific cuts, and the dog’s behavior. Bathing, drying, brushing, nail trimming, and styling all take time. Stressed or anxious dogs may require additional handling to ensure safety. Complex or specialty cuts significantly extend grooming duration.
The frequency of grooming depends on breed, coat type, and lifestyle. Short-haired dogs may only need grooming every 6–8 weeks, while long-haired or high-maintenance breeds often require grooming every 4–6 weeks. Regular brushing between sessions helps prevent matting. Professional grooming ensures coat health, cleanliness, and nail care.
The hardest dogs to groom are usually long-haired, double-coated, or high-maintenance breeds such as Afghan Hounds, Shih Tzus, and Samoyeds. Thick mats, sensitive skin, and active behavior increase grooming difficulty. Groomers may need specialized tools and techniques. Anxiety or aggression in some dogs can also make the process challenging.
Dogs can typically go 6–12 weeks without professional grooming, depending on breed and coat type. Long-haired or fast-growing breeds may develop mats, tangles, and skin issues sooner. Regular brushing at home can extend the interval between professional grooming. Neglecting grooming for too long can lead to discomfort or health problems.
